I have bought a Wells-Gardner 19" D9100 digital monitor. Does any one else use this one? I was planning on using a u3100 monitor but the salesperson told me that it would take 6 weeks to ship it to The Netherlands and that he had another better Wells monitor in stock he could sell me for the same price.
This monitor can take a frequency between 30-68 khz (u3100 31.5-35.5) and a resolution up to 1280x1024 non-interlaced.
A very nice feature of the monitor is that it has a seperate control board that connects to the monitor with a cable. With this board you can adjust many setting like size, contrast etc. I am planning to mount this board on the backside of the coindoor so I can adjust the settings on the fly.
The only drawback that I can see off using this monitor is that the display is a little sharper (.39 dot pitch) then the u3100 (.76 dot pitch).
